Mesothelioma and Asbestos Lawyer
A mesothelioma and asbestos lawyer can help victims and their families get compensation from sources like trust funds, VA benefits and personal injury lawsuits. They can also pinpoint possible exposure sources for victims who aren't sure where they were exposed to asbestos.
A mesothelioma lawyer must have experience working with asbestos firms across the country and a track record of obtaining substantial settlements. They should offer a free assessment of the case.
Selecting a National Company
Mesothelioma lawyers often specialize in a specific area of law. Picking a firm that has experience in the area of law they are interested in will give them a better chance to receive the maximum amount of compensation.
Asbestos sufferers must also select an attorney with a national presence. If required the lawyer will be able to file lawsuits across multiple states. This flexibility is vital for veterans who might have been exposed to asbestos in many different states during their military service.
Attorneys in firms that specialize in asbestos litigation have access to a wealth resources, including extensive databases on asbestos. These databases include information on asbestos-related products, manufacturers, and contaminated job sites. They can aid victims and their families link mesothelioma to a previous exposure to asbestos.
Additionally, mesothelioma attorneys should have the ability to assist veterans in filing VA benefits claims. These cases are separate from mesothelioma lawsuits and provide financial compensation aswell medical care.
Mesothelioma law firms should offer the opportunity to receive a no-cost, no-obligation case evaluation. This allows victims to meet with a mesothelioma lawyer and find out more about the legal options available. The meeting also provides victims the chance to ask questions regarding the legal process.
In addition to providing an unbeatable consultation mesothelioma attorneys should also have a an established track record of winning compensation for their clients. This money can aid the patients and their families pay for medical expenses and secure their families' future. A good mesothelioma lawyer will work on contingency basis, meaning they only get paid when the victim is compensated.
Mesothelioma, a rare type of cancer caused by exposure to asbestos for a prolonged period of time, is a terrible and rare disease. The companies that used and sold asbestos-containing products must be held liable for their actions. Legal actions and trust fund claims can help asbestos victims and their families to recover compensation for lost income, medical expenses, and other damages. A mesothelioma attorney should be able to explain the statutes of limitations and how they apply to your specific situation.

Asbestos, a noxious material is used in manufacturing, construction and other industries for decades. Mesothelioma is a danger for people who worked with asbestos-containing materials, such as pipe, insulation, or sealants. Even a small amount of exposure can trigger this condition, which affects the lung's lining abdomen, lungs, and heart.
There are a variety of mesothelioma types, and each has its own symptoms. The treatment for mesothelioma may be costly and affect the patient's future ability to work. Mesothelioma suits may include compensation for loss of income as well as wages.
Wrongful death lawsuits are another important aspect of mesothelioma lawsuits. These cases are filed by family members who have suffered the loss of a loved one due to asbestos exposure. Family members can be awarded compensation for funeral expenses as well as loss of companionship and other damages.
In accordance with their state victims and their families could be eligible for compensation from the asbestos trust fund. These trusts were created by the bankruptcy of asbestos-producing or asbestos-using companies. These trusts are designed to hold assets that can be used to pay asbestos-related legal costs. The benefits of these trusts can substantially increase the amount of mesothelioma lawsuit settlements. The most reputable asbestos and mesothelioma lawyers have a strong financial foundation that allows them to negotiate large settlements on behalf of their clients. This includes national law firms like Weitz & Luxenberg or Simmons Hanly Conroy that have recovered billions of dollars in settlements for clients.
